About this work

This painting depicts a forest landscape, with trees and foliage in various shades of green, brown, and yellow. The brushstrokes are loose and expressive, giving the scene a sense of movement and energy. In the foreground, the trees are densely packed, with trunks and branches visible in shades of brown and gray. The leaves are a vibrant green, with hints of yellow and orange. The background is more muted, with softer colors and less defined shapes. The overall effect is one of depth and atmosphere, drawing the viewer into the forest. Yrjö Aleksanteri Ollila (20 July 1887, Helsinki – 14 November 1932, Helsinki) was a Finnish Impressionist painter, designer and muralist.
